P0868 on 2007-2017 Jeep Compass: CVT Transmission Fluid Pressure Low Causes and Fixes
On a 2007-2017 Jeep Compass with the CVT, code P0868 most often points to low or degraded transmission fluid, or clogged filters. A fluid and filter service using the correct CVTF+4 fluid is the most common starting point for a fix. Neglecting the external cooler filter is a frequent cause of repeat issues.

What's Unique About the 2007-2017 Jeep Compass
The 2007-2017 Jeep Compass uses a Jatco JF011E Continuously Variable Transmission (CVT), which is different from a traditional automatic. These CVTs are known to be sensitive to fluid condition and level. Unlike many cars, they do not have a traditional dipstick for checking fluid, requiring a special service tool and a specific temperature-based procedure. Furthermore, P0868 on this platform is often a secondary code, pointing to underlying issues like a faulty stepper motor (P1778) or a worn flow control valve in the oil pump, rather than just a bad pressure sensor. A critical, and often overlooked, feature is the presence of two filters: a standard pan filter and a paper cartridge filter for the cooler, located behind the driver's side wheel well liner.
Symptoms You May Notice
- Check Engine Light is on
- Vehicle enters 'limp mode' with reduced power
- Transmission slipping or hesitating during acceleration
- Whining or humming noise from the transmission that may rise with engine RPM
- Vehicle feels sluggish or won't accelerate properly
- Overheating transmission, sometimes with a burning smell
- Delayed engagement when shifting into Drive or Reverse

Most Likely Causes
- Low or Degraded CVT Fluid 🔴 High Probability The Jatco CVT is sensitive to fluid quality and level. Leaks from the pan gasket, cooler lines, or axle seals are common. The fluid also degrades over time, losing its hydraulic properties, which is a primary cause of failure in this transmission.
How to confirm: Check the fluid level using a special service dipstick (e.g., part number 9336) and a temperature-to-level chart. The fluid should be at the correct level for its temperature and should not be dark brown, black, or smell burnt. The check must be done with the engine running and the transmission at a specific operating temperature.
Typical fix: If low, top off with Mopar CVTF+4 fluid (OEM Part # 5191184AB) and locate and repair the source of the leak. If the fluid is old or dirty, perform a drain and fill, replacing both filters.
Est. part cost: $50-$150 for fluid - Clogged CVT Filters 🔴 High Probability These transmissions have two filters: one in the pan (sump filter) and an external paper cartridge filter for the cooler. The external cooler filter is often overlooked during service, leading to blockages that restrict flow and reduce pressure. It is located behind the driver's side wheel well liner, in a housing attached to the transmission.
How to confirm: Inspect the filters during a fluid service. A dark, saturated external filter or excessive debris in the pan filter indicates a blockage. The old fluid will often look very dark or black.
Typical fix: Replace both the internal (pan) filter and the external cooler filter during a fluid service. This is considered a mandatory step for addressing P0868.
Est. part cost: $40-$80 for both filters and pan gasket - Failing CVT Oil Pump (Flow Control Valve) 🟡 Medium Probability The flow control valve within the oil pump can wear out its bore, creating an internal pressure leak. This is a well-documented failure mode in the Jatco JF011E, causing slipping, delayed engagement, and low pump output.
How to confirm: This is difficult to confirm without disassembly. It's typically diagnosed after ruling out fluid, filters, and sensors. Dropping the pan and finding significant metallic debris can be an indicator of advanced wear. A transmission specialist may be required.
Typical fix: The valve bore can be reamed and fitted with an oversized valve kit, such as the Sonnax 33510N-01. In many cases, the entire oil pump or the complete transmission assembly needs to be replaced.
Est. part cost: $30-$50 for a Sonnax valve kit, $200-$500 for a pump, $2500+ for a rebuilt transmission - Faulty Transmission Fluid Pressure Sensor ⚪ Low Probability The sensor can fail electronically, sending an incorrect low-pressure signal to the TCM even when the pressure is normal. However, this is less common than fluid/filter or mechanical pump issues.
How to confirm: Use a scan tool to monitor the pressure sensor reading. Compare this to the actual pressure measured with a mechanical gauge connected to a test port on the transmission. If the readings differ significantly, the sensor is likely faulty.
Typical fix: Replace the transmission fluid pressure sensor. This is often located on the valve body, requiring removal of the transmission pan.
Est. part cost: $70-$150
Rare But Worth Checking
- Faulty Stepper Motor or Pressure Control Solenoid: A technical document for the Jatco JF011E suggests that P0868 can be a secondary code caused by a failing stepper motor (related to code P1778) or pressure solenoid (P0776). If these codes are present alongside P0868, they should be addressed as the primary fault.
- Faulty Transmission Control Module (TCM): While rare, the TCM itself can fail, leading to incorrect pressure readings or commands. This is usually the last item to suspect after all other mechanical and electrical causes have been ruled out.
Diagnosis Steps
- Scan for all DTCs. Note if P0746, P1778, or P0776 are present, as they may indicate the root cause.
- Check the transmission fluid level and condition. This requires a special dipstick tool (e.g., 9336) and a temperature chart. The engine must be running and the fluid at operating temperature.
- If the fluid is low, add the correct Mopar CVTF+4 fluid (Part # 5191184AB) and inspect for leaks from the pan, cooler lines, and seals.
- If the fluid is dark, burnt, or has not been changed in over 30,000-50,000 miles, perform a fluid and filter service. CRITICAL: Replace both the internal pan filter and the external cartridge filter. The external filter is located in a housing on the side of the transmission, accessible after removing the driver's side wheel well liner.
- After service, clear the codes and perform a test drive. If the code P0868 returns, proceed with further diagnosis.
- Use a scan tool to monitor the transmission fluid pressure sensor data. Compare this to a reading from a mechanical pressure gauge to verify if the sensor is accurate.
- If the sensor is inaccurate, replace it. This requires draining the fluid and removing the transmission pan.
- If the sensor is accurate and the pressure is confirmed to be low despite clean fluid and new filters, the issue is likely internal. Inspect the valve body for faulty solenoids or a sticking stepper motor.
- If the valve body is functioning correctly, the issue is likely a worn oil pump flow control valve or other internal transmission failure, which may require transmission replacement or specialized repair of the pump body.

Related Codes That Often Appear With This One
- P0746 — Indicates a performance issue with the pressure control solenoid, often related to the same hydraulic pressure loss that triggers P0868.
- P1778 — Points to a problem with the stepper motor that controls the pulley ratio. A malfunctioning stepper motor can lead to incorrect pressures, triggering P0868.
- P0776 — Indicates a fault with the secondary pressure solenoid. This is directly related to hydraulic control and can cause the overall line pressure to be low.
Platform-Specific Known Issues
- The Jatco JF011E CVT used in this vehicle has two transmission filters; the external cooler filter is frequently missed during service, leading to flow restrictions and pressure problems.
- The lack of a factory-installed dipstick makes checking the fluid level difficult for DIYers and can lead to incorrect fluid levels if not performed correctly with the proper tool and temperature chart.
Mechanic-Grade Diagnostic Values
- Pressure Control Solenoid (A or B) Resistance — expected: 3.0 - 7.0 Ohms. Failure: Reading outside of this range indicates a faulty solenoid coil.
- Torque Converter Clutch Solenoid Resistance — expected: 3.0 - 7.0 Ohms. Failure: Reading outside of this range indicates a faulty solenoid coil.
- Lock-Up Select Solenoid Resistance — expected: 17.0 - 38.0 Ohms. Failure: Reading outside of this range indicates a faulty solenoid coil.
- CVT Fluid Temperature Sensor Resistance — expected: ~6.5 kOhms at 20°C (68°F) or ~0.9 kOhms at 80°C (176°F). Failure: Significantly different resistance at a known temperature indicates a bad sensor.
- Secondary Pressure Sensor Signal Circuit Voltage Check — expected: 4.5 - 5.5 Volts. Failure: Voltage outside this range when the signal circuit is jumped to the 5V reference indicates a wiring or TCM issue.

Wiring & Ground Locations
- G102 / G103 — Located on the top of the transmission case.. These are the primary grounds for the Transmission Control Module (CVT) and the Transmission Solenoid/Pressure Switch Assembly. A poor connection at these points can cause erratic sensor readings and solenoid function, potentially triggering P0868.
- Transmission Control Module (TCM) — Located high up in the driver's side footwell, behind the kick panel and above the brake pedal.. Technicians may mistakenly look for the TCM in the engine bay or assume it's integrated with the PCM. Knowing its exact, difficult-to-access location is key for checking its connectors for corrosion or damage, which could cause this code.

Model Year Variations Within This Range
- 2014-2017: Starting in 2014, a 6-speed conventional automatic transmission (PowerTech 6F24) became available and replaced the CVT on many trims. However, the CVT remained available, particularly on models equipped with the Freedom Drive II off-road package. It is critical to verify which transmission the vehicle has before ordering parts.
- 2017: For the 2017 model year, the first-generation Compass (with the CVT option) was sold alongside the all-new second-generation Compass. The second-generation model does NOT use the Jatco CVT.
- 2007-2009 vs 2010+: The valve body was changed in 2010 to remove the primary pressure switch. The parts are not interchangeable between these year ranges without causing fault codes.

Other Known Issues on This Vehicle
Issues unrelated to this code that are worth knowing about as an owner of this generation:
- Front and Rear Subframe Corrosion 🔴 High — Very common on vehicles in the salt belt. Can become structurally unsafe. (Ref: Warranty Extension X69 (TSB 23-007-17) extended coverage to 10 years for 2008-2012 models in certain regions.)
- Water Leaks into Cabin 🟠 Medium — Frequently reported, often from clogged sunroof drains or failed body/windshield seam sealer. (Ref: STAR Case S1823000053 provides dealer guidance for A-pillar leaks.)
- Electronic Throttle Body Failure 🟠 Medium — Common issue causing the 'lightning bolt' warning light, limp mode, and lack of acceleration. Often occurs around 60k-80k miles.
- Prematurely Worn Suspension Components 🟠 Medium — Owners report early failure of struts, ball joints, and tie rods, leading to poor ride quality and noise.
- Crankshaft or Camshaft Sensor Failure 🔴 High — Can cause intermittent stalling. More prevalent on certain model years. (Ref: NHTSA Campaign Number: 16V461000 (Recall for some 2016 models).)
